Transaction 4f5df17e0db5ccccb1bb580d603280d817b0df5a5d723fb17aad62347b1a7bf5

29 Input
1 Outputs
  • 4f5df17e0db5ccccb1bb580d603280d817b0df5a5d723fb17aad62347b1a7bf5:0
  • value  3252409
    address  3NffSATWUcucgxrdA7rLZyfjeFMwrESdtK